Efficiency And Energy Savings
Energy efficiency is a critical factor for long-term operating costs. Sanyo air conditioners typically align with standard U.S. efficiency expectations for consumer-grade units, though efficiency varies by model and class. Look for the following indicators:
- SEER or EER ratings: Higher values indicate better cooling efficiency, especially for longer runtime in warm climates.
- Energy Star qualification: When available, Energy Star-certified models meet stricter energy performance criteria.
- Inverter technology: Inverter-driven compressors can adjust speed to match cooling demand, often improving efficiency and reducing peak power draw.
For users prioritizing energy savings, selecting a unit with a higher efficiency rating and inverter technology is advisable. Additionally, proper sizing—matching BTUs to room size—reduces overworking the compressor, further lowering energy use and extending unit life.

Tips For Installation, Operation, And Maintenance
Effective setup and ongoing care maximize comfort and efficiency. Consider these best practices:
- Accurate sizing: Use a BTU calculator or professional guidance to match unit capacity to room dimensions and insulation levels.
- Seal and insulate: Ensure window or wall openings are properly sealed to minimize air leakage and improve efficiency.
- Placement considerations: Position portable units away from heat sources and ensure adequate clearance for airflow.
- Regular maintenance: Clean or replace filters monthly during peak season and inspect for ice buildup on coils.
- Smart controls: If available, utilize programmable or smart thermostats to optimize cooling schedules and energy use.
Following these practices helps maintain consistent temperatures, lowers energy bills, and extends unit life. For complex installations, especially with multi-split or ducted options, professional installation is recommended to ensure proper refrigerant charge and airflow.
